@@ -0,0 +1,15 @@
|
||||
"""Unwrap (possibly nested) exception groups to the first plain Exception.
|
||||
anyio task groups deliver a concurrent CLI crash + cancellation as a
|
||||
BaseExceptionGroup whose str() names the group, not the cause; classifying the
|
||||
group instead of the member turns a retryable 429 into a raw error card."""
|
||||
from typing import Optional
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def first_real_exception(exc: BaseException) -> Optional[Exception]:
|
||||
if isinstance(exc, BaseExceptionGroup):
|
||||
for p_sub in exc.exceptions:
|
||||
p_found = first_real_exception(p_sub)
|
||||
if p_found is not None:
|
||||
return p_found
|
||||
return None
|
||||
return exc if isinstance(exc, Exception) else None
